Smoking a cigar takes know-how and a certain degree of skill in order to get the full scope of aroma, flavor, and pleasure out of your cigar. Properly smoking a cigar, involves three things which must be done so that the cigar smoking experience can be maximized. Cutting the cigar, lighting the cigar, and finally, smoking the cigar correctly will have you looking and feeling like a cigar connoisseur in no time.
First off, you’ll need what else? Cigars! For starters, I highly recommend buy something along the lines of a sampler pack. The thompson cigar company sampler, brings many of the big name brands and after trying each one, you can find what suits your taste.
Cutting the cigar or preparing the cigar for lighting has to be done correctly, so as to maintain the integrity of the wrapper and hence the quality of the cigar.

Some tips on smoking a cigar at a cigar lounge:
- Bring your own only if your a member
- Cigarettes shouldn’t really be smoked in a cigar lounge
Remember above all the owner is there to make money.
